SIDDHARTHA SUMAN
SIDDHARTHA SUMAN

Reputation: 11

Explode simple XML file in pyspark (Not using databricks)

I have a XML file which is given below :

<?xml version="1.0" encoding="UTF-8"?>
<items>
    <item id="0001" type="donut">
        <name>Cake</name>
        <ppu>0.55</ppu>
        <batters>
            <batter id="1001">Regular</batter>
            <batter id="1002">Chocolate</batter>
            <batter id="1003">Blueberry</batter>
        </batters>
        <topping id="5001">None</topping>
        <topping id="5002">Glazed</topping>
        <topping id="5005">Sugar</topping>
        <topping id="5006">Sprinkles</topping>
        <topping id="5003">Chocolate</topping>
        <topping id="5004">Maple</topping>
    </item>
</items>

How can i explode batter and topping and flatten it into table format ?

Upvotes: 0

Views: 166

Answers (0)

Related Questions